WebApr 3, 2024 · Similarly, there is a lack of strong evidence supporting the use of phosphatidylserine for cognitive health. Wenk also mentioned that there isn’t any evidence that dietary intake of phosphatidylserine will increase the amount of this nutrient reaching the brain. Natural supplements can actually cause harm WebA study that tracked the mental functioning and multivitamin use of 5,947 men for 12 years found that multivitamins did not reduce risk for mental declines such as memory loss or slowed-down thinking. A study of 1,708 heart attack survivors who took a high-dose multivitamin or placebo for up to 55 months.
